Rama Navami (Sanskrit: राम नवमी, romanized: Rāmanavamī) is a Hindu festival that celebrates the birthday of Rama, the seventh avatar of the deity Vishnu. The festival celebrates the descent of Vishnu as the Rama avatar, through his birth to King Dasharatha and Queen Kausalya in Ayodhya, Kosala.

World Hindi Day, or Vishwa Hindi Diwas, is celebrated every year on January 10 as an important day for celebrating and promoting the rich cultural and linguistic heritage of Hindi and its speakers around the world. It is a day for people to come together and celebrate the language and its rich history, and to recognise the important role that it plays in the world today. The celebration of World Hindi Day has its roots in the early 20th century, when Hindi was first recognised as an official language of India. The first World Hindi Day was celebrated in 2006.In today's time, people are inclined toward speaking and learning English, which is understood as it is used across the world and is also one of the official languages of India.
